First gen Breitling!
Biggest differences between gen and BOTH JF chronomat and GF chronomat:
1) Sub dial spacing - JF and GF are equivalent.
2) Date wheel - JF better.
3) Bezel Font - GF better, JF clicks better font is still great on JF.
4) Sub dial hands - Raised slightly higher on genuine. JF and GF are equivalent.
5) Case back - engraving on gen is much better and besides the date wheel and subdial spacing, this is the biggest tell.. JF has wrong caseback. .’. GF better.
6) satisfying pusher feel/sound - JF hands down “feels/sounds more like gen B01 when pushing, starting/stopping/resetting and snapping back of chronograph..

All in all, it’s a tough call, but, for me, the JF is for sure the better rep... maybe I just got a bogus GF who knows...
